v1.02 (fix) released...

Wed Dec 28, 2005 7:11 pm

No delays on this one! I've corrected a couple of errors in v1.01 of the current roster update for NBA Live 06 and released it as v1.02. I apologise for any inconvenience, the fixed version is available for download here.

Fixes in v1.02:
- Tyson Chandler's contract fixed
- ID numbers in players.dbf/appearance.dbf corrected
- Corrected Ben Wallace and Shaquille O'Neal's Freestyle Superstar moves

Features from v1.01:
- 2005/2006 Rosters accurate as of 26/12/05
- Player ratings updated
- Primacy ratings adjusted for better shot distribution
- Player positions, gear and data updated/corrected
- Player contracts & salaries updated
- Missing legends added, complete with cyberfaces
- Some missing cyberfaces added
- Teamgear updated
- FAQ section added to Update.txt


Again, apologies for the inconvenience, but v1.02 should be free of any problems (though keep the suggestions for ratings updates coming ;)). See below for a Changelog if you want to manually update a Dynasty in progress with the fixes.

CHANGELOG

If you want to update a Dynasty you've started with v1.01, follow these instructions:

1. Make a backup of your Dynasty save in case anything goes wrong.

2. Using a DBF editor such as DBF commander, open players.dbf

3. Locate Tyson Chandler. Change his CASH_YEAR value to 10600

4. Locate the first entry for Ben Wallace. Change his VALIDSSTAR value to 176 and his SUPERSTAR value to 160

5. Locate the first entry for Shaquille O'Neal. Change his VALIDSSTAR to 160 and SUPERSTAR value to 160.

6. Reconciling the IDs in players.dbf and appearance.dbf is simple, especially if you're using DB Commander or another DBF editor that allows you to work on two files simultaneously. Simply open up players.dbf and appearance.dbf, scroll to the bottom and make sure the very last entries in each database are lined up. Then it's simply a matter of changing the IDs in appearance.dbf to the ones on the corresponding row in players.dbf.

EDIT: I looked through to see who has Superstar abilities, and I saw a few who only needed like a 2-3 point rating boost to get a realistic ability, here's the list:

- Brevin Knight to Playmaker - O. Awareness 80 to 81
- Z. Ilgauskas to Ins. Scorer - O. Awareness 81 to 85
- Kenyon Martin to Power - Hardiness 75 to 80
- Jermaine O'Neal to Ins. Stopper - Def. Rebound 77 to 80
- Kevin Garnett to Ins. Stopper - Block 79 to 80

I think those are worth the ratings boost.

don't you still let the superstar abilities be determined by the game using the ratings? .... so if you legitimately change the ratings down and the game does not consider them a superstar anymore then why bump them back up just for that? - I thought bumping guys for a side effect was a no-no.

The game as it came from EA was full of overrated players purely cos EA bumped them to make them superstars....we are still bumping guys just so they can have a few moves?

Thu Dec 29, 2005 8:42 am

A lot of changes I made were slight. Raising a rating a couple of notches isn't a stretch. Besides, a lot of the changes were inadvertent because I forgot about the additional effect of the Hardiness rating.

I won't change every player back but I'll consider a few, like Jermaine O'Neal and Kevin Garnett.
